Courtney Campbell, DVM Surgical Resident
Raised among the saplings in the heavily wooded forests of Connecticut, Courtney Campbell graduated from a modestly small high school in Burlington, CT. In Connecticut, he developed a bona fide interest in nature and mammals. He then transmuted those interests into a Bachelor of Science in Animal Science/Pre-Veterinary Medicine from the University of Delaware. His educational journey brought him to the southeastern United States where he earned his D.V.M. Degree from Tuskegee University in Alabama. After graduation, Courtney worked as a general practitioner at the Connecticut Veterinary Center in West Hartford, CT. Courtney received advanced surgical training with a rotating internship at Affiliated Veterinary Specialists in Maitland, Florida as well as a surgical internship at Las Vegas Veterinary Referral Center in Las Vegas, Nevada. Courtney moved to Los Angeles and continued pursuing his surgical interests with a surgical internship at Animal Surgical Emergency Center.
Courtney is deeply interested in being proficient in the newest surgical techniques and their clinical applications. He is also very interested in the pathophysiology of inflammatory gastrointestinal disease. In his spare time, he enjoys studying surgery, learning new languages, and understanding the geopolitical aspects of economics.
